The A-Channels Equalizer and Output Control register is used to control the confi guration of the input equalizer and output emphasis
and levels of the four A channels. These register bits are loaded from the input confi guration pins of the same name at power-on.
These bits may be changed if the MODE# input is set to allow I2C confi guration. Please refer to the tables (1) Equalizer Confi gura-
tion, (2) Output Swing Confi guration and (3) Output Emphasis Confi guration earlier in this document for setting information. All
four A channels get the same confi guration settings.
BYTE 9 - B-Channels Equalizer and Output Control (BEOC)
SELx_B: Equalizer confi guration, Dx_B: Emphasis control, Sx_B: Output level control (see Confi guration Table)
Note: R=Read only, W=Write only, R/W=Read and Write, X=Undefi ned, rsvd=reserved for future use
The B-Channels Equalizer and Output Control register is used to control the confi guration of the input equalizer and output emphasis
and levels of the four B channels. These register bits are loaded from the input confi guration pins of the same name at power-on.
These bits may be changed if the MODE# input is set to allow I2C confi guration. Please refer to the tables (1) Equalizer Confi gura-
tion, (2) Output Swing Confi guration and (3) Output Emphasis Confi guration earlier in this document for setting information. All
four B channels get the same confi guration settings.
BYTE 10 - Reserved
BYTE 11 - Reserved
Reserved Bytes 10 and 11 are also visible via the I2C interface. These bytes are R/W, are initialized to 0 at power up, are used for IC
manufacturing test purposes and should not be changed for normal operation.
Start & Stop Conditions
A HIGH to LOW transition on the SDA line while SCL is HIGH indicates a START condition. A LOW to HIGH transition on the
SDA line while SCL is HIGH defi nes a STOP condition, as shown in the fi gure below.
